/* DDR2 VTP Calibration */
|
|
void
|
|
ddr_vtp_calibration(void)
|
|
{
|
|
/* DO VTP calibration:
|
|
* Clear CLR & PWRDN & LOCK bits */
|
|
SYSTEM->VTPIOCR &= ~(DEVICE_VTPIOCR_PWRDN_MASK |
|
|
DEVICE_VTPIOCR_LOCK_MASK |
|
|
DEVICE_VTPIOCR_CLR_MASK);
|
|
|
|
/* Un-clear VTP */
|
|
SYSTEM->VTPIOCR |= DEVICE_VTPIOCR_CLR_MASK;
|
|
|
|
/* Wait for ready */
|
|
while (!(SYSTEM->VTPIOCR & DEVICE_VTPIOCR_READY_MASK));
|
|
|
|
/* Set bit VTP_IO_READY */
|
|
SYSTEM->VTPIOCR |= DEVICE_VTPIOCR_VTPIOREADY_MASK;
|
|
|
|
/* Enable power save mode and lock impedance */
|
|
SYSTEM->VTPIOCR |= (DEVICE_VTPIOCR_PWRSAVE_MASK |
|
|
DEVICE_VTPIOCR_LOCK_MASK);
|
|
|
|
/* Powerdown VTP as it is locked */
|
|
SYSTEM->VTPIOCR |= DEVICE_VTPIOCR_PWRDN_MASK;
|
|
|
|
/* Wait for calibration to complete */
|
|
waitloop(150);
|
|
}
